Lath cutter
Technical field
The present invention relates to a kind of lath cutters.
Background technology
Lath cutter is used to cut off plank, including upper knife body, lower knife body and elevating mechanism, upper knife body are fixed on the rack, There is upper knife edge on upper knife body, there is lower blade, lower knife body to be driven by elevating mechanism and be moved relative to upper knife body, shearing on lower knife body When, lower knife body is moved relative to upper knife body, is cut plank by the shearing force of upper and lower blade.The elevating mechanism one of existing lath cutter As be hydraulic cylinder or cylinder, hydraulic cylinder acts on the middle part of lower knife body, the problem is that, when lower knife body volume is larger, liquid Cylinder pressure, which only acts upon, is susceptible to the unstable situation of lower knife body movement in the middle part of lower knife body, and hydraulic cylinder is arranged in lower knife body both sides The quantity of hydraulic cylinder certainly will be increased to increase lower knife body stability then, and multiple hydraulic cylinders need to run simultaneously, control cost compared with It is high.

Specific implementation mode
To make the technical means, the creative features, the aims and the efficiencies achieved by the present invention be easy to understand, with reference to Specific implementation mode, the present invention is further explained.
Figure is please referred to, the present invention provides a kind of technical solution:A kind of lath cutter, including rack 10, upper knife body 20, lower knife body 30 and elevating mechanism 40, upper knife body 20 be fixed in rack 10, rack 10 includes left and right column and connects left and right column Bottom girder 101, lower knife body 30 is located at the lower section of upper knife body 20 and can be moved up and down along rack 10, the driving lower knife body 30 of elevating mechanism 40 It is moved relative to upper knife body 20 to shear plank.Elevating mechanism 40 can be the mechanisms such as hydraulic cylinder or crank block.
Balance leverage 50 is equipped between lower knife body 30 and the bottom girder of rack 10 101, balance leverage 50 includes left and right crank 501,502 and left and right connecting rods 511,512, left and right crank 501,502 is symmetrically set in the both sides of 30 longitudinal center of lower knife body, left, Right connecting rod 511,512 is also symmetrically set in the both sides of longitudinal center, and the lower end of left and right crank 501,502 is hinged with rack 10, The upper end of left and right crank 501,502 is hinged with the lower end of left and right connecting rods 511,512 respectively, the upper end of left and right connecting rods 511,512 It is hinged with lower knife body 30.Left and right connecting rods 511,512 are connected to the both sides at 30 center of lower knife body, when lower knife body 30 moves up and down, Left and right crank 501,502 is swung around the articulated shaft 523,524 of itself and bottom girder 101, and left and right connecting rods 511,512 can make lower knife body 30 Both sides, which are supported, makes it keep balance, stationarity when enhancing lower knife body 30 moves up and down.
Elevating mechanism 40 includes left and right screw rod 401,402, pivoted housing 403, lifting seat 404 and rotating mechanism, lifting seat 404 It is liftable to be arranged on the bottom girder 101 of rack 10, specifically, sliding slot is provided on bottom girder 101, the lower part of lifting seat 404 and cunning Slot slides vertically cooperation, and the left side of left screw rod 401 is socketed on left crank 501 and the articulated shaft 521 of left connecting rod 511, right screw rod 402 right side is socketed on the articulated shaft 522 of right crank 502 and right connecting rod 512, the right side and left side of left and right screw rod 401,402 Respectively be inserted into pivoted housing 403 in and with 403 screw-thread fit of pivoted housing, the thread rotary orientation of left and right screw rod 401,402 is on the contrary, rotating mechanism On lifting seat 404 and pivoted housing 403 is driven to rotate.Rotating mechanism such as motor etc. drives pivoted housing 403 by gear or belt etc. Rotation, the rotation of pivoted housing 403 will drive left and right screw rod 401 simultaneously towards or away from movement, and left and right screw rod is towards or away from shifting While dynamic, left and right crank 501,502 will be driven towards or away from swing by articulated shaft 521,522, to realize lower knife body 30 Lifting, left and right screw rod 401,402 closer or far from while, due to articulated shaft 521, the change of 522 positions, left and right screw rod 401 and pivoted housing 403 also will lifting, the lifting of left and right screw rod 401 and pivoted housing 403 is realized by lifting seat 404.Elevating mechanism 40 integral levels are arranged, and are moved horizontally by left and right screw rod to realize the lifting of lower knife body 30, and equipment overall structure is compact, left, The horizontal applied force of right screw rod is acted on by left and right connecting rods on lower knife body, and lower knife body lifting is more steady.
The bottom girder 101 of rack 10 is equipped with the spring 410 of support lifting seat 404, by spring 410 come buffer lift seat 403。
